Subject: [PATCH] mm: change memcg->oom_group access with atomic operations
Date: Mon, 20 Feb 2023 23:16:38 +0800	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20230220151638.1371-1-findns94@gmail.com> (raw)

The knob for cgroup v2 memory controller: memory.oom.group
will be read and written simultaneously by user space
programs, thus we'd better change memcg->oom_group access
with atomic operations to avoid concurrency problems.

Signed-off-by: Yue Zhao <findns94@gmail.com>
---
 mm/memcontrol.c | 6 +++---
 1 file changed, 3 insertions(+), 3 deletions(-)

diff --git a/mm/memcontrol.c b/mm/memcontrol.c
index 73afff8062f9..e4695fb80bda 100644
--- a/mm/memcontrol.c
+++ b/mm/memcontrol.c
@@ -2057,7 +2057,7 @@ struct mem_cgroup *mem_cgroup_get_oom_group(struct task_struct *victim,
 	 * highest-level memory cgroup with oom.group set.
 	 */
 	for (; memcg; memcg = parent_mem_cgroup(memcg)) {
-		if (memcg->oom_group)
+		if (READ_ONCE(memcg->oom_group))
 			oom_group = memcg;
 
 		if (memcg == oom_domain)
@@ -6569,7 +6569,7 @@ static int memory_oom_group_show(struct seq_file *m, void *v)
 {
 	struct mem_cgroup *memcg = mem_cgroup_from_seq(m);
 
-	seq_printf(m, "%d\n", memcg->oom_group);
+	seq_printf(m, "%d\n", READ_ONCE(memcg->oom_group));
 
 	return 0;
 }
@@ -6591,7 +6591,7 @@ static ssize_t memory_oom_group_write(struct kernfs_open_file *of,
 	if (oom_group != 0 && oom_group != 1)
 		return -EINVAL;
 
-	memcg->oom_group = oom_group;
+	WRITE_ONCE(memcg->oom_group, oom_group);
 
 	return nbytes;
 }
